  3. cgaugi replied to happyotter's topic in PHP
    Ric Is this the same way I can downgrade from PHP 5.3.x to for e.g. 5.2.16? - I have downloaded Uniserver 5.7.0 Nano. - Unzipped un launched once as you described. - Downloaded PHP 5.2.16 VC6 x86 Thread Safe and extracted to UniServer\usr\local\php, previously original directory renamed to UniServer\usr\local\php53 - Compared two php.ini files and copy-pasted absolute paths - I have created copies of php.ini, copied eaccelerate.dll into extensions dir, which was renamed to match uniform one name convention. It seems that UniServer\unicon\main\includes\config.inc.php does not need to be changes as it is ok As well as UniServer\udrive\usr\local\apache2\bin\ does not originally contain libmcrypt.dll, so I did nothing here. BUT when I launch Unitray and press Start Uniserver I gent an error: Title: Apache.exe - Entry Point Not Found Msg: The procedure entry point pass_two could not be located in the dynamic link library php5ts.dll I have double checked the php directory and it does contain php5ts.dll. Admin panel seems working so PHP and Apache is working but, what can cause an error?!
